Learn about CVE-2021-21858, multiple high-severity integer overflow vulnerabilities in GPAC Project Advanced Content library v1.0.1. Discover impact, affected systems, and mitigation measures.
Multiple exploitable integer overflow vulnerabilities exist within the MPEG-4 decoding functionality of the GPAC Project Advanced Content library v1.0.1. These vulnerabilities can be triggered by a specially crafted MPEG-4 input, leading to heap-based buffer overflow and memory corruption when unchecked addition arithmetic causes an integer overflow. Attackers can exploit this by convincing users to open a video file.
Understanding CVE-2021-21858
CVE-2021-21858 is a high-severity vulnerability in the GPAC Project Advanced Content library v1.0.1 due to integer overflow issues in MPEG-4 decoding.
What is CVE-2021-21858?
CVE-2021-21858 refers to multiple exploitable integer overflow vulnerabilities in the GPAC Project Advanced Content library v1.0.1. These vulnerabilities can be triggered by specially crafted MPEG-4 inputs.
The Impact of CVE-2021-21858
The impact of CVE-2021-21858 is high, with a base score of 8.8 according to the CVSS v3.0 system. It can result in heap-based buffer overflow, leading to memory corruption and a potential avenue for attackers to compromise systems.
Technical Details of CVE-2021-21858
The technical details of CVE-2021-21858 provide insights into the vulnerability, affected systems, and the exploitation mechanism.
Vulnerability Description
The vulnerability arises from integer overflow issues within the MPEG-4 decoding functionality of the GPAC Project Advanced Content library v1.0.1. It occurs due to unchecked addition arithmetic, resulting in a heap-based buffer overflow and memory corruption.
Affected Systems and Versions
The affected systems include GPAC Project Advanced Content commit a8a8d412dabcb129e695c3e7d861fcc81f608304 and GPAC Project Advanced Content v1.0.1.
Exploitation Mechanism
Exploiting CVE-2021-21858 requires a specially crafted MPEG-4 input to trigger the integer overflow, leading to the subsequent heap-based buffer overflow and memory corruption.
Mitigation and Prevention
To mitigate the risks associated with CVE-2021-21858, immediate steps should be taken alongside long-term security practices and patching procedures.
Immediate Steps to Take
Users and organizations should be cautious when opening MPEG-4 files from untrusted sources. It is crucial to apply security updates and patches promptly to protect systems from potential exploitation.
Long-Term Security Practices
Implementing secure coding practices, conducting regular security assessments, and staying informed about potential vulnerabilities are essential long-term security measures.
Patching and Updates
Vendors and users should ensure they apply relevant patches released by software providers promptly.